The Freeze-Drying Process: Preserving Goodness

To achieve this, we use a process called lyophilisation, commonly known as ‘freeze-drying’. (To properly do this, we need to make the soup extremely cold, and then vacuum the surrounding air so that the ice inside the suspension of soup will convert directly from ice to vapour — sublimation. This is the end of the destination called lyophilisation. Although this notes how things are done, it is not lyophilisation itself.) At the end of this process is a lightweight, shelf-stable product. You add water, and, in minutes, you have the aromas and flavour of home-cooked soup.

Benefits of Freeze-Dried Soups

Long Shelf Life: Year after year, thanks to the absence of water, freeze-dried soups stay intact as when they were produced.

Nutrient Retention: Freeze-drying locks in vitamins and minerals to make sure these soups aren’t just easy on your schedule but also easy on your diet.

Convenience and portable: Not requiring refrigeration and light-weighted are all advantages of freeze-dried soups, which are ideal to bring along when camping and hiking trips, travelling, or in busy work days.

So Many Choices: From traditional vegetable and chicken noodle, to decadent international flavours, and even sweet varieties – there’s a soup that’s right for you!

Simple Preperation: Just add hot water and rice instantly become a nutreous hot meal!
